Exploring early examples and foundational theories in psychometrics reveals essential milestones that have shaped contemporary psychological assessment. One of the pioneering figures was Sir Francis Galton, who, in the late 19th century, laid the groundwork for psychometric testing by emphasizing individual differences and developing methods for measuring intelligence through statistical approaches. His work was crucial in the emergence of statistical theory applied to psychology, and his 1884 article in the *Journal of the Anthropological Institute* highlighted the importance of testing variability in human traits. Additionally, in 1916, Lewis Terman published the Stanford-Binet Intelligence Scale, which provided standardized measures that culminated in the establishment of IQ testing as a dominant method of assessing cognitive ability (American Psychological Association, n.d.).
In the early 20th century, the rise of psychometric theories prominently featured the work of psychologists such as Charles Spearman, who introduced the concept of "g" factor theory in his 1904 article published in *The American Journal of Psychology*. Spearman's statistical methods demonstrated that a general intelligence factor could be extracted from various cognitive tests. His insights have profoundly influenced the design of modern assessments focusing on multiple intelligence facets while still reflecting a core of general cognitive ability. The development of psychometric assessments has been marked by significant milestones that have profoundly shaped modern psychological evaluation. One of the earliest groundbreaking innovations came in 1905 when French psychologist Alfred Binet and his colleague Théodore Simon introduced the first practical intelligence test, the Binet-Simon scale. This innovative tool, designed to identify children in need of special educational assistance, laid the groundwork for contemporary IQ tests. Within a decade, Lewis Terman adapted Binet's work into the Stanford-Binet Intelligence Scale, transforming it into a standard tool for measuring intelligence in the United States. In the evolution of psychometric testing, statistics have emerged as a transformative force, reshaping how we evaluate psychological attributes. The advent of standardized measurement in the early 20th century marked a turning point in assessments. Pioneers like Charles Spearman introduced the concept of general intelligence and the g-factor, employing statistical methods to quantify mental abilities. His 1904 publication "The Evidence for the General Factor" in the *American Journal of Psychology* laid the groundwork for future test development by emphasizing the importance of reliability and validity . As psychometry matured, the integration of sophisticated statistical techniques allowed for the refinement of test items and the establishment of norms across diverse populations. Item Response Theory (IRT) emerged as a critical methodology, facilitating more nuanced interpretations of test scores beyond simple right-or-wrong answers. Research indicates that IRT enhances the precision of assessments by considering the difficulty level of questions and the traits of the respondents, thus leading to a greater understanding of individual capabilities . Statistical methods play a crucial role in enhancing both the reliability and validity of psychometric tests. Recent studies have demonstrated that robust statistical analysis can effectively quantify and improve test consistency over time. For instance, a study published in the Wiley Online Library highlights the application of Item Response Theory (IRT) in psychometrics, which provides a more refined understanding of how different items function within a test framework. By utilizing IRT, researchers can identify underperforming items that may compromise overall test reliability. Moreover, the validity of psychometric tests is significantly enhanced through the application of statistical methodologies. Recent approaches, such as Structural Equation Modeling (SEM), allow researchers to assess the relationships between latent constructs and observed variables more effectively.
